HOUSTON, Texas – U.S. Sen. Ted Cruz (R-Texas) today released a new video in observance of Veterans Day, honoring those who have bravely served in our nation’s Armed Forces. Sen. Cruz also participated in the City of Houston’s 19th Annual “Houston Salutes American Heroes” Veterans Day Celebration, where he recognized the selfless sacrifices and unyielding courage of our veterans. 

“On this Veterans Day, we stand together as a state and as a nation to recognize the sacrifice of the brave servicemen and women of our Armed Forces,” Sen. Cruz said in the video. “For your service, sacrifice, and unyielding courage - we say ‘thank you.’ Thank you for raising your right hand and swearing to protect our American way of life. Thank you for your selfless devotion to defending our freedom and defending our Constitution. It is because of you that our country remains a shining city on a hill, the last best hope of man on earth.” 

On Thursday, Sen. Cruz visited the Michael E. DeBakey VA Medical Center in Houston and paid tribute to veterans in a Veterans Day Ceremony. Sen. Cruz recently visited the Audie L. Murphy Memorial VA Hospital and Brooke Army Medical Center in San Antonio, and in August, Cruz hosted a roundtable discussion with veterans in Corpus Christi. Sen. Cruz, along with Sen. John Cornyn (R-Texas) and Gov. Greg Abbott, in March sent a letter to U.S. Secretary of Veterans Affairs Robert McDonald calling on him to address the improper scheduling practices and extended wait times for veterans seeking health care across the entire State of Texas.
